Weary but determined, women join Ukraine's fight against Russia in historic numbers

KOSTIANTYNIVKA, Ukraine — Sitting in the ruins of a bombed-out school close to the front lines in eastern Ukraine, Halyna Liutikova fills the overcast air with an infectious laugh.

Despite the setting, the 28-year-old remains cheerful — but admits that the exhaustion of two years of war is taking its toll.

“We are really tired,” said Liutikova, who is weighed down not just by the bulletproof vest beneath her camouflage gear, but also by the months of endless fighting to defend her country. “Because two years, it’s a lot.”

She’s not alone, in more ways than one.

Liutikova is among the historic number of women who have signed up to join the fight against Russia’s advancing forces as Ukraine works to bolster its beleaguered ranks.

Two of those female soldiers told NBC News on Tuesday that, like their male comrades, they were weary as the war approaches the two-year mark. Kyiv’s troops are under growing Russian pressure with little respite and now frustrated by a lack of support from the United States. But unlike their male comrades, they also said they were facing another challenge: sexism.
